The Role: We are looking for a driven, detail-oriented Construction Management Intern to join our team for a 12-week intensive summer program in our San Francisco, CA. This is not a "coffee-run" internship. You will be embedded directly into our project management teams, gaining hands-on experience in the planning, execution, and delivery of complex digital infrastructure projects. The Goal: We view this internship as a 12-week interview. Our primary goal is to identify high-performing individuals to join Crusoe full-time upon graduation. Successful completion of this program offers a direct pathway to a full-time offer. Internship Dates: May 18, 2026 - August 7, 2026 June 1, 2026 - August 21, 2026 June 15, 2026- September 4, 2026 Statistics from our 2025 Program: Interns would rate their overall internship experience a 4.45/5 91% of interns would recommend this internship to a friend or peer 93% of interns would recommend their manager to participate in the program again next year 94% of interns would recommend their mentor to participate in the program again next year What You Will Do Project Controls: Assist Project Managers (PMs) with the processing of RFIs (Requests for Information), Submittals, and Change Orders. Scheduling: Help maintain and update project schedules using tools like Primavera P6 or Microsoft Project; track milestones and flag potential delays. Field Coordination: Walk job sites (or virtually review site progress) to monitor safety compliance, quality control, and adherence to design specifications. Vendor Management: Coordinate with subcontractors, material suppliers, and design teams to ensure just-in-time delivery of critical components. Cost Management: Assist in budget tracking, quantity take-offs, and invoice verification. Safety First: Champion Crusoe’s safety culture by participating in safety audits and toolbox talks. Who You Are Education: Currently pursuing a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Construction Management, Civil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or a related field. Note: Preference given to students graduating between Dec 2026 and Spring 2027. Technical Skills: Proficiency in MS Office (specifically Excel) is required. Experience with Procore, Bluebeam, AutoCAD, or P6 is a strong plus. Soft Skills: You are a clear communicator who isn't afraid to pick up the phone. You have "grit" and thrive in fast-paced, dynamic environments. Mobility: Willingness to travel to project sites if required. The 12-Week Roadmap We structure the summer to ensure you leave with a holistic view of the construction lifecycle: Weeks 1-4 (Onboarding & Pre-Con): Learn our systems (Procore/Financials), understand the scope of upcoming builds, and assist with estimation/bidding. Weeks 5-8 (Execution): Deep dive into active project management. You will own a specific work package or process (e.g., managing the electrical submittal log). Weeks 9-12 (Closeout & Review): Assist with punch lists and project commissioning. Present your summer capstone project to leadership. Why Join the Crusoe 2026 Cohort? Impact: Work on cutting-edge projects involving modular construction, cryogenics, and high-performance computing. Mentorship: You will be paired with a Senior Project Manager who will provide weekly 1:1 coaching and career development.
